Read the full statutory text
This chapter does not apply to the activities of a public agency that operates facilities of the State Water Resources Development System that are jointly owned by the state and the United States, including facilities of the San Luis Unit of the Central Valley Project, if the activities are conducted pursuant to, and consistent with, an agreement with the United States for the operation and maintenance of those facilities.
